Understanding Hyperthyroidism During Pregnancy:
Hyperthyroidism is characterized by an overproduction of thyroid hormones, primarily thyroxine (T4) and triiodothyronine (T3). During pregnancy, the body undergoes significant hormonal changes, which can potentially exacerbate hyperthyroidism symptoms or even lead to the development of the condition for the first time. It is crucial for pregnant women with hyperthyroidism to receive appropriate medical care to ensure a healthy pregnancy.

Medication Options and Considerations:
Antithyroid drugs (ATDs) are the most common form of medication used to treat hyperthyroidism during pregnancy. Propylthiouracil (PTU) and methimazole (MMI) are the two primary ATDs prescribed. PTU is generally recommended during the first trimester due to a slightly lower risk of birth defects, while MMI is often preferred during the second and third trimesters due to its better tolerability.
It is important to note that both PTU and MMI can cross the placenta, potentially affecting the developing baby's thyroid function. Regular monitoring of thyroid hormone levels, particularly free thyroxine (FT4) and thyroid-stimulating hormone (TSH), is crucial to ensure that the medication dosage is appropriate and to prevent both over- and under-treatment.
